DHS awards $18M for NBACC architectural design to Perkins & Will Group, Ltd

Contract Overview

Contract Amount: $18,016,395 ($18.0M)

Contractor: Perkins & Will Group, Ltd., the

Awarding Agency: Department of Homeland Security

Start Date: 2005-03-21

End Date: 2010-09-07

Contract Duration: 1,996 days

Daily Burn Rate: $9.0K/day

Competition Type: FULL AND OPEN COMPETITION

Number of Offers Received: 10

Pricing Type: FIRM FIXED PRICE

Sector: Other

Official Description: A/E DESIGN NATIONAL BIODEFENSE ANALYSIS COUNTERMEASURES CENTER (NBACC)
